Only watch it for Leo Luo

I was quite skeptical whether to start watching as the reviews weren't that good. But from the trailer it looks like Leo Luo was pretty charming so I decided to go ahead.

The overall series was just normal, sufficient amount of fighting scenes and romantic scenes, but nothing big to entice people to love the series. Shang Guan Tou was a pretty charming character from the start to the end, he was beautiful, smart, protective and gentle which gives you no reason to not love him. HOWEVER, on the other hand, the female lead was a totally opposite character. Not one of but the WORST female lead character I've ever met in all C-dramas. She supposed to be skillful as she learnt the powerful Kungfu, supposed to be brave and smart as she was the clan leader, but instead she was dumb, weak, useless, immature, dependent, cry baby and acts rashly. I understand that male lead are always the heroic ones to save the female lead, was this female lead is just TOO WEAK. The male lead was always injured because of the girl but instead he is always the one to save the female lead from baddies when she is actually more skillful in terms of Kungfu, like WHAT? It is so not realistic. Also, when the male lead saves her for so many times, she chose to left him with some absurd misunderstanding, so I personally felt the love story is just so frustrating and I disliked it a lot.

In conclusion, story was okay but female lead character was extremely unfavourable. Not recommended but you can consider if you enjoy watching Leo Luo.
